MITHANI
Mithani is a surname of Indian origin, belonging to the Gujarati linguistic and cultural tradition. It is most commonly found within the Indian sub‑continent, particularly among communities residing in the western state of Gujarat.
In the Gujarati language, the root word mitha translates to “sweet.” The surname Mithani is believed to have arisen from this word, originally serving as a nickname for an individual whose manner or disposition was characterised as pleasant or sweet‑minded. The addition of the suffix -ani is a common practice in Gujarati surnames, often indicating a family lineage or clan association.
Although the name is widespread within India, it is especially prevalent among the Gujarati Muslim community. The surname therefore reflects both linguistic heritage and religious identity within that demographic segment. Nonetheless, it is occasionally encountered among Hindus who share Gujarati ancestry, illustrating the cultural fluidity of naming practices in the region.
The principal language associated with bearers of the surname is Gujarati, yet many individuals also speak Hindi in daily life, given its status as a lingua‑language of the country. The demographic distribution of the surname is primarily within India, and it remains a marker of Gujarati heritage across broader Asian contexts.
